Biography of Lemmy Kilmister
Lemmy Kilmister, born Ian Fraser Kilmister on December 24, 1945, in Burslem, Staffordshire, England, was a renowned musician, singer, and songwriter. He is best known as the founder, lead singer, bassist, and primary songwriter of the rock band Motörhead. Lemmy's music career spanned over five decades, during which he became a symbol of the rock and roll lifestyle.
Known for his raspy voice, distinctive bass playing, and iconic mutton chops, Lemmy's influence on the heavy metal genre is undeniable. He was a pioneer who broke conventional barriers with his unique style, blending rock, punk, and heavy metal influences to create a sound that was distinctly his own. His passion for music and his rebellious spirit made him a beloved figure in the rock community.
Below is a table summarizing Lemmy Kilmister's personal details:
Full Name | Ian Fraser Kilmister |
---|---|
Date of Birth | December 24, 1945 |
Place of Birth | Burslem, Staffordshire, England |
Occupation | Musician, Singer, Songwriter |
Known For | Founder of Motörhead |
Date of Death | December 28, 2015 |

Career and Musical Journey
Lemmy Kilmister's musical journey began in the 1960s when he played in various bands, including The Rockin' Vickers and Sam Gopal. However, it was his time with the band Hawkwind that marked a significant turning point in his career. As a bassist and vocalist for Hawkwind, Lemmy contributed to several of the band's most successful albums, including "Space Ritual" and "Doremi Fasol Latido."
In 1975, after parting ways with Hawkwind, Lemmy founded Motörhead. The band quickly gained a reputation for their loud, energetic performances and their fusion of rock and heavy metal. Motörhead's breakthrough album, "Ace of Spades," released in 1980, became a defining moment in their career, solidifying their place in rock history.
Lemmy's distinctive voice and aggressive bass playing became trademarks of Motörhead's sound. The band's relentless touring and dedication to their fans earned them a loyal following worldwide. Despite numerous lineup changes over the years, Lemmy remained the constant driving force behind Motörhead until his passing in 2015.
Did Lemmy Kilmister Have a Wife?
The question of "Lemmy Kilmister wife" often arises among fans who are curious about the personal life of the rock legend. Despite his numerous relationships and his candidness about his romantic life, Lemmy never married. He once famously stated, "I was only ever in love once, but nobody believed me."
Lemmy's reluctance to marry was rooted in his belief that his lifestyle and commitment to music were not conducive to a traditional married life. He valued his independence and the freedom to live life on his own terms. While he had deep connections with several women throughout his life, he chose not to formalize these relationships through marriage.
